Loose cattle reported near North Perry Road in Jennings TownshipScott County IN

audio iconOther Non-Crime Event
W Harrod Rd, Jennings Township, IN 47102

Loose cattle were reported near North Perry Road and Harrod Road in Jennings Township. Attempts to reach the possible owner (name withheld) at a nearby address were initially unsuccessful. Later, contact was made with the cattle owner who, with help from others, was working to secure the animals.
